#96f5a0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96f5a0 is composed of 58.8% red, 96.1%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 126.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 77.5%. #96f5a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2deb41.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#96f5a0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#96f5a0 has RGB values of R:150, G:245,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9893280.

Hex triplet 96f5a0 #96f5a0
RGB Decimal 150, 245, 160 rgb(150,245,160)
RGB Percent 58.8, 96.1, 62.7 rgb(58.8%,96.1%,62.7%)
CMYK 39, 0, 35, 4
HSL 126.3°, 82.6, 77.5 hsl(126.3,82.6%,77.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 126.3°, 38.8, 96.1
Web Safe 99ff99 #99ff99
CIE-LAB 89.076, -45.096, 32.317
XYZ 51.573, 74.324, 44.884
xyY 0.302, 0.435, 74.324
CIE-LCH 89.076, 55.48, 144.373
CIE-LUV 89.076, -45.494, 53.019
Hunter-Lab 86.212, -44.089, 29.48
Binary 10010110, 11110101, 10100000

Shades and Tints of #96f5a0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f0f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#96f5a0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c9c3 is the less saturated color, while #8dfe99 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#96f5a0 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cfcfcf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c4d7c6 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f3e19c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ffdabc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b0eafb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d1e89e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d8e4b2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a6eeda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
